The Nairobi City County is the creation of the Constitution of Kenya 2010 and successor of the defunct City Council of Nairobi. It operates under the auspices of the Cities and Urban Areas Act, The Devolved Governments Act and a host of other Acts.

Screening, assessing, formulating and implementing patients’ treatment plan
Carrying out clients’ functional assessment and formulating necessary interventions
Initiate appropriate therapy intervention programs for patients & clients with disabilities in the Hospital and in the community.
Maintaining records and data relating to patients
Liaise with other healthcare professionals to exchange information about the background and progress of patients, as well as to refer patients who require other medical attention;
Sensitizing the community on occupational Therapy issues
Preparing periodic reports
Job Qualifications
Kenya Certificate of Secondary Education -K.C.S.E., grade C or above or its equivalent with passes in the relevant subjects.
Diploma in Occupational Therapy from a recognized institution
Membership certificate of the Kenya Occupational Therapists Association
Certificate in computer application skills from a recognized institution
Skills to communicate effectively with patients and colleagues.
